SENATE G.O.P. LEADER STILL SEEKS NEW DATE FOR PRIMARY

Senate Majority Leader Joe Pittman says he’s still trying to find a way to move the state’s primary on Republican terms.  The lawmaker from Indiana has notified Governor Josh Shapiro that Senate Republicans have no intention of moving a House-passed bill that would change the date of the 2024 spring primary to April 3rd. However, the County Commissioners Association of Pennsylvania has said there is no longer enough time for counties to handle the tasks associated with moving next year’s primary election from the current date, which is set by law as April 23rd.
